Objectives: To determine concentrations of adiponectin and its predictive value on outcome in a cohort of patients with congestive heart failure (CHF). Methods: Serum and clinical data were obtained for outpatients with clinically controlled CHF (n = 175). Serum concentrations of adiponectin, C reactive protein, N-terminal pro-brain natriuretic peptide (NTproBNP), interleukin (IL) -1b, IL-6, IL-8, IL-10, IL-12, tumour necrosis factor a and CD-40 ligand were determined. The association of adiponectin with the clinical severity of CHF was sought as well as the predictive value of this adipokine on mortality, CHF hospitalisations or the occurrence of each of these end points.Results: Concentrations of adiponectin were significantly increased in patients with CHF. Patients with higher New York Heart Association class had significantly higher serum concentrations of adiponectin. Adiponectin serum concentrations were lower in patients with diabetes and CHF as well as in patients with ischaemic cardiomyopathy. Serum adiponectin concentration was positively associated with age and NTproBNP but was negatively correlated with C reactive protein concentrations. Serum adiponectin above the 75th centile was found to be an independent predictor of total mortality, CHF hospitalisations or a composite of these end points over a two-year prospective follow up. Conclusion: Adiponectin is increased in CHF patients and predicts mortality and morbidity.

Abstract-Supine hypertension occurs commonly in primary chronic autonomic failure. This study explored whether supine hypertension in this setting is associated with orthostatic hypotension (OH), and if so, what mechanisms might underlie this association. Supine and upright blood pressures, hemodynamic responses to the Valsalva maneuver, baroreflex-cardiovagal gain, and plasma norepinephrine (NE) levels were measured in pure autonomic failure (PAF), multiple-system atrophy (MSA) with or without OH, and Parkinson's disease (PD) with or without OH. Controls included age-matched, healthy volunteers and patients with essential hypertension or those referred for dysautonomia. Baroreflex-cardiovagal gain was calculated from the relation between the interbeat interval and systolic pressure during the Valsalva maneuver. PAF, MSA with OH, and PD with OH all featured supine hypertension, which was equivalent in severity to that in essential hypertension, regardless of fludrocortisone treatment. Among patients with PD or MSA, those with OH had higher mean arterial pressure during supine rest (109Ϯ3 mm Hg) than did those lacking OH (96Ϯ3 mm Hg, Pϭ0.002). Baroreflex-cardiovagal gain and orthostatic increments in plasma NE levels were markedly decreased in all 3 groups with OH. Among patients with PD or MSA, those with OH had much lower mean baroreflex-cardiovagal gain (0.74Ϯ0.10 ms/mm Hg) than did those lacking OH (3.13Ϯ0.72 ms/mm Hg, Pϭ0.0002). In PAF, supine hypertension is linked to both OH and low baroreflex-cardiovagal gain. The finding of lower plasma NE levels in patients with than without supine hypertension suggests involvement of pressor mechanisms independent of the sympathetic nervous system. Fabry disease is an X-linked disorder caused by a deficiency of lysosomal alpha-galactosidase A resulting in accumulation of alpha-D-galatosyl conjugated glycosphingolipids. Clinical manifestations include a small-fiber neuropathy associated with debilitating pain and hypohidrosis. We report the effect of a 3-year open-label extension of a previously reported 6-month placebo-controlled enzyme replacement therapy (ERT) trial in which 26 hemizygous patients with Fabry disease received 0.2 mg/kg of alpha-galactosidase A every 2 weeks. The effect of ERT on neuropathic pain scores while off pain medications, quantitative sensory testing, quantitative sudomotor axon reflex test (QSART), and thermoregulatory sweat test (TST) is reported. In the patients who crossed-over from placebo to ERT (n = 10), mean pain-at-its-worst scores on a 0-10 scale decreased (from 6.9 to 4.5). There was a significant reduction in the threshold for cold and warm sensation in the foot. At the 3-year time-point, pre-ERT sweat excretion in 17 Fabry patients was 0.24 +/- 0.33 microl/mm(2) vs. 1.05 +/- 0.81 in concurrent controls (n = 38). Sweat function improved 24-72 h post-enzyme infusion (0.57 +/- 0.71 microl/mm(2)) and normalized in four anhidrotic patients. TST confirmed the QSART results. We conclude that prolonged ERT in Fabry disease leads to a modest but significant improvement in the clinical manifestations of the small-fiber neuropathy associated with this disorder. QSART may be useful to further optimize the dose and frequency of ERT.

Abstract-Recently the Joint National Committee on the Prevention, Detection, Evaluation, and Treatment of High Blood Pressure introduced the term "prehypertension" for systolic blood pressure levels of 120 to 139 mm Hg and diastolic BP levels of 80 to 89 mm Hg. Little is known about the prevalence of this entity and the cardiovascular risk factors associated with it. We aimed to determine the prevalence of prehypertension and the cardiovascular risk factors associated with it in a large population-based sample of young Israeli adults. We studied 36 424 Israel Defense Forces employees during the years 1991 to 1999. Subjects completed a detailed questionnaire and underwent physical examination, and blood samples were drawn after a 14-hour fast. Prehypertension was defined as a systolic blood pressure of 120 to 139 mm Hg, and/or a diastolic blood pressure of 80 to 89 mm Hg. We calculated the age-and sex-specific prevalence of prehypertension and other cardiovascular risk factors associated with this condition. Prehypertension was observed among 50.6% of men and 35.9% of women. The prehypertensive group had higher levels of blood glucose, total cholesterol, low-density lipoprotein cholesterol, and triglycerides, higher body mass index, and lower levels of high-density lipoprotein cholesterol than did the normotensive group. Multivariate logistic regression analysis showed that body mass index was the strongest predictor of prehypertension among both males and females (odds ratio, 1.100; 95% CI, 1.078 to 1.122 and odds ratio, 1.152; 95% CI, 1.097 to 1.21, respectively, for every 1 kg/m 2 increase). Our findings support the recommendation of lifestyle modification for prehypertensive patients. Further prospective studies are required to determine the role of pharmacotherapy in prehypertension.
